Fred Pratt Green
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
The Reverend Fred Pratt Green (1903-2000) CBE was a Methodist minister, beginning his ministry in the Filey circuit. His lasting contribution to Methodism and the church at large is the large number of hymns he wrote.
His hymns reflect Pratt Green's rejection of fundamentalism and show his concern with social isues
Green's hymns appear in hymn books of various denominations, but most notably in Hymns and Psalms, the hymn book of the Methodist Church.
In looking for his hymns in hymnal indexes, one must bear in mind that some hymnbooks alphabetize him under G, some under P.
